Description Marcus Harrison 2012-11-06 12:19:56 UTC
Description of problem:
Unsure exactly what I did to produce this crash, but at the time I was both trying to get Akonadi's Nepomuk feeder to start indexing again (from a "system is busy, indexing suspended" message in akonadiconsole) and had added some folders to Nepomuk's file indexing configuration.

Version-Release number of selected component:
nepomuk-core-4.9.2-5.fc17

Additional info:
libreport version: 2.0.18
abrt_version:   2.0.18
backtrace_rating: 4
cmdline:        /usr/bin/nepomukservicestub nepomukstorage
crash_function: QCoreApplication::postEvent
kernel:         3.6.3-1.fc17.x86_64

truncated backtrace:
:Thread no. 1 (10 frames)
: #0 QCoreApplication::postEvent at kernel/qcoreapplication.cpp:1339
: #1 QMetaMethod::invoke at kernel/qmetaobject.cpp:1703
: #2 QMetaObject::invokeMethod at kernel/qmetaobject.cpp:1179
: #3 invokeMethod at /usr/include/QtCore/qobjectdefs.h:434
: #4 Nepomuk2::ResourceWatcherManager::createResource at /usr/src/debug/nepomuk-core-4.9.2/services/storage/resourcewatchermanager.cpp:262
: #5 Nepomuk2::ResourceMerger::merge at /usr/src/debug/nepomuk-core-4.9.2/services/storage/resourcemerger.cpp:941
: #6 Nepomuk2::DataManagementModel::storeResources at /usr/src/debug/nepomuk-core-4.9.2/services/storage/datamanagementmodel.cpp:1805
: #7 Nepomuk2::StoreResourcesCommand::runCommand at /usr/src/debug/nepomuk-core-4.9.2/services/storage/datamanagementcommand.h:166
: #8 Nepomuk2::DataManagementCommand::run at /usr/src/debug/nepomuk-core-4.9.2/services/storage/datamanagementcommand.cpp:62
: #9 QThreadPoolThread::run at concurrent/qthreadpool.cpp:107
